Naurang Village Population, Sex Ratio & Literacy Rate

Naurang is a village in Dabwali tehsil, Sirsa district, Haryana, India. As per Census 2011, the total population is 2217, sex ratio is 86.4592094196804 females per 1,000 males, and the overall literacy rate is 54.71%. The PIN code of Naurang is 125201.
